Job Summary: The goal of this position is cleanliness, safety, and accuracy of the shipping center, including all aspects of understanding parts inventory, communication for support, manual picking, and adhering to all shipment SWI's. The role requires understanding customer expectations and escalating to supervisors and leads when needed.
Main Duties and Responsibilities- Understand all loading and picking requirements for kitting and sequencing shipments to TMMTX.
- Maintain a clean and safe working environment.
- Hold themselves accountable for following all safety and other policies and procedures, and for behavior and performance that meet company expectations.
- Report any imminent late or short shipments to a lead or supervisor and assist with retrieving parts when short.
- Use wrist RF scanners for picking and loading according to manifest and sequences.
- Apply a continuous improvement approach to increase efficiency and safety.
- Reduce potential property damage.
- Uphold standardized work as the key tool for success.
- Willing to learn how to operate a forklift.
- Other duties may be assigned.
